Kyrie Irving (UFA)

At this point, it’s practically a given that Kyrie Irving will not be returning as a member of the Celtics; he’s already declined his player option and the damage his unorthodox personality has caused in that locker room is irreparable. Obviously, the question is, where does he go next?

Ever since the Celtics got bounced out of the playoffs by the Bucks, the Kyrie to Brooklyn train has picked up major steam. Other reports even hinted at a possible reunion with LeBron James in the City of Angels. Aside from that, it’s highly doubtful any high-end free agent will consider going to the Knicks (aside from one person in particular, who could provoke a domino effect).

With that being said, there is simply too much smoke to start a fire with those Brooklyn rumors. In the eyes of many, this will prove to be a mistake; after all, just use last season as a reference. But if he and a man who’s first name starts with a K decide to join forces in Brooklyn, things will obviously be different.

Verdict: Kyrie Irving heads to The Borough of Trees.
